How to Replace Trailer Bearings: Master the Maintenance

To replace trailer bearings, first secure your trailer on jack stands and remove the wheel and hub carefully. Pry off the dust cap, remove the cotter pin and castle nut, then slide the hub off to access the bearings.

Remove and discard old bearings, cups, and seals. Clean and inspect all parts for damage or wear. Pack new bearings generously with marine grease, install new seals, and reassemble with proper torque and new cotter pins.

Remove the Hub and Bearings Safely

With your trailer securely lifted and the tire assembly removed, you’re ready to take off the hub and bearings.

Begin by prying off the dust cap using a flathead screwdriver. Next, straighten and remove the cotter pin with needle-nose pliers.

Then unscrew the castle nut by hand and remove the washer. Carefully pull the hub straight off the spindle, catching the outer bearing as it comes free.

Dispose of the old cotter pin properly. Flip the hub over to expose the inner bearing and seal, preparing for their removal.

Throughout this process, support the hub adequately to prevent damage. Inspect the spindle for any signs of wear or damage before proceeding to the next step.

Removing Inner Bearing Cup

To remove the inner bearing cup, start by cleaning the outer bearing cup thoroughly to guarantee no debris interferes with the process. Support the hub on sturdy wood blocks to prevent damage.

Use a brass drift punch and a hammer to tap the inner bearing cup out carefully, applying steady, even force around the cup’s circumference. Avoid deforming the hub or spindle during removal. Once loose, knock out the inner bearing with a wood dowel and mallet using a circular motion. Discard old cups and bearings after removal.

Extracting Grease Seal

Once you’ve knocked out the inner bearing, attention turns to removing the grease seal.

The grease seal typically comes out with the inner bearing, but if it remains stuck, use a flathead screwdriver or seal puller to pry it carefully from the hub.

Insert the tool between the seal lip and hub, applying gentle, even pressure to avoid damaging the hub surface.

Work around the seal evenly until it loosens and pops free.

Inspect the seal area and hub bore for any damage or corrosion before proceeding.

Remove any residual grease or debris to guarantee a clean surface for the new seal.

Discard the old grease seal and bearing cups.

Proper extraction prevents damage to the hub and guarantees a secure fit for replacement components.

Spindle Thread Condition

Examine the spindle threads carefully for any flat spots or deformities, especially on EZ lube types where a D-shaped thread may appear. Damaged threads can prevent proper nut tightening, risking bearing failure. Use a magnifying glass or bright light to spot irregularities.

Check the following:

  • Thread integrity: No flattening, cross-threading, or burrs
  • EZ lube port condition: Clean and unobstructed for grease flow
  • Spindle surface: Smooth and free of corrosion or nicks

If you find damage, repair or replace the spindle before proceeding. Proper thread condition guarantees the castle nut seats securely, maintaining bearing preload.

Bearing And Race Wear

Although you’ve inspected the spindle threads, you also need to carefully check the bearings and races for wear or damage before installation.

Examine the bearing surfaces for pitting, scoring, or discoloration, which indicate overheating or contamination.

Rotate bearings to detect rough spots or binding.

Inspect the races inside the hub, looking for grooves, cracks, or uneven wear patterns.

Any signs of damage mean you must replace the bearings and races to prevent premature failure.

Wipe off excess grease and debris to get a clear view.

Never reuse old cups or bearings, as compromised components can lead to unsafe operation.

Ensuring all parts are in optimal condition maintains proper alignment, load distribution, and smooth rotation when you reassemble the hub onto the spindle.

Pack and Install New Trailer Bearings Properly

Begin by thoroughly packing the new bearings with grease, guaranteeing every roller and cage gap is filled to prevent premature wear. Use a grease packer or your hands to force grease into all bearing surfaces.

Next, apply a generous amount of grease inside the bearing cup to ensure smooth seating. When installing the bearings, follow these steps:

Insert the inner bearing cone into the hub cup, making sure it’s fully seated. Press the new grease seal carefully into place, using light sealant on the edge for a secure fit.

Slide the hub onto the spindle, then position the outer bearing and washer correctly. Proper packing and installation reduce friction and extend bearing life, so take your time to avoid contamination.

Reassemble Hub Bearings: Nuts, Cotter Pins, and Dust Caps

Once the bearings are properly packed and seated, secure the hub by tightening the castle nut to the manufacturer’s specified torque.

After torquing, align the castle nut slot with the hole in the spindle to insert a new cotter pin. Bend the cotter pin ends firmly around the spindle to prevent loosening.

Next, install the washer if removed during disassembly, ensuring it sits flush against the nut.

Finally, press the dust cap or grease cap onto the hub using a rubber mallet or by hand, making sure it’s seated evenly to protect bearings from dirt and moisture.

Confirm the dust cap fits snugly without gaps. This completes the reassembly of the hub bearings, preparing the hub for wheel installation and safe operation.

Torque the Wheel and Reinstall the Tire Safely

Secure the tire by aligning it with the wheel studs and sliding it onto the hub. Hand-tighten the lug nuts to hold the tire in place.

Once the tire is seated, use a torque wrench to tighten the lug nuts in a crisscross or star pattern. This guarantees even pressure and proper seating of the wheel.

Tighten lug nuts to the manufacturer’s specified torque to avoid damage or loosening. Recheck torque after the first few miles of towing to maintain safety.

Lower the trailer carefully from jack stands, confirming stability. Proper torque and safe tire installation prevent wheel wobble, uneven wear, and potential accidents.

How Often Should Trailer Bearings Be Replaced?

You should replace trailer bearings every 12,000 to 15,000 miles or at least once a year, whichever comes first.

If you notice noise, roughness, or excessive heat near the hubs, inspect and replace bearings immediately.

Regular maintenance, including cleaning, greasing, and inspection, extends bearing life.

Don’t wait for failure; proactive replacement prevents costly damage and guarantees safe towing performance.

Always follow your trailer manufacturer’s recommendations for intervals.

What Type of Grease Is Best for Trailer Bearings?

You should use high-temperature, water-resistant wheel bearing grease for trailer bearings.

Look for a grease with a lithium complex or synthetic base, which handles heat and moisture well.

This type prevents corrosion and withstands heavy loads and wet conditions.

Avoid general-purpose grease, as it lacks the necessary properties.

Always pack bearings thoroughly with this grease before installation to guarantee smooth operation and extended bearing life.

Can I Reuse Old Bearings if They Look Clean?

You shouldn’t reuse old bearings even if they look clean. Bearings endure wear and stress that aren’t always visible.

Reusing them risks premature failure, causing damage and safety hazards. Always replace bearings with new, properly greased ones during maintenance.

This guarantees peak performance and longevity. It’s a small investment compared to potential breakdowns or accidents.

Prioritize safety and reliability by installing fresh bearings every time.

How to Tell if a Bearing Is Overheating?

You can tell if a bearing is overheating by checking for discoloration, such as a blue or dark tint on the bearing or races.

Overheating often causes a burnt smell or grease breakdown, making it appear dry or contaminated.

You might also notice rough rotation or excessive play when spinning the hub.

If you feel excessive heat near the hub after use, that’s a clear sign the bearing’s running too hot and needs inspection or replacement.

What Are the Signs of Spindle Damage?

You’ll spot spindle damage by checking for flat spots, scoring, or grooves on the spindle surface.

Look for deformation, cracks, or pitting around bearing contact areas. If you have an EZ lube spindle, inspect the D-shaped section for wear or distortion.

Any roughness or uneven surfaces can cause bearing failure, so replace the spindle if you notice these signs to guarantee safe and smooth trailer operation.
